GRAPHIC DESIGN AND CONTENT CREATOR TEMPORARY FULL-TIME The Town of Morinville is a growing community on the doorstep of Metro Edmonton. Developed on a foundation of rich heritage and culture spanning 100+ years, it offers an excellent quality of life with convenient access to all nearby big city amenities while retaining the characteristics of a vibrant and flourishing centre for the surrounding rural community. The Town of Morinville is seeking a dynamic and eager creative person who has a passion for graphic design. This position has an end date of on or before April 30, 2023, based on operational requirements. Working within theCommunications Team, the Graphic Design and Content Creator will oversee graphic design services for the municipality, provide support for social media, update and monitor Town website as well as supplement and assist daily corporate communication activities.Key objectives of this position include:

  • Work collaboratively with the Communications Team to develop graphics that promote the Town of
Morinville’s strategic priorities, vision and mission.
  • Translate marketing and communications strategies into effective content for website, digital & print media.
  • Collaborate with internal Departments; provide design concepts & solutions.
  • Analyze marketing data collected across platforms to assess the effectiveness and optimize the performance of digital assets, social media accounts, and Town website.
  • Ensure content creation, production and execution timelines are met.
  • Monitor progress of projects, including the tracking of all project files and archives, and provide continuous communication to the Supervisor, Corporate Communications regarding on-going project and status updates.
  • Serve as an in-house resource for managing the content and media files.
  • Assist in monitoring and updating social media, website, and other digital platforms.
Requirements:
  • Post-Secondary education in Digital Communications, Graphic Design, Communications, Public Relations or a related discipline (equivalent combinations of education and experience may be considered).
  • Two years experience working in Graphic Design, Communications, Public Relations or a related discipline.
  • Minimum of one year experience in a municipal or government communications setting, considered an asset.
  • Extensive experience with Adobe Creative Suite is required as well as adv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office applications including Word, PowerPoint and Excel.
  • Understanding of search engine optimization and web traffic metrics.
  • Strong organizational, time management and project management skills with a demonstrated ability to work both independently and within a team environment.
  • Class 5 Driver’s License is required.
  • The successful candidate will be required to provide an acceptable Criminal Record Check and Drivers Abstract.
Compensation/Hours of Work: $29.63 to $35.38 per hour based on a 35-hour work week.
